Russian businessman caught smuggling large quantity of tobacco products
A local businessman in Krasnoyarsk, Russia was caught with over 23,800 packs of cigarettes and 2,800 packs of unmarked tobacco.

According to Sibnovosti on August 5th, in the Krasnoyarsk Krai region of Russia, a local businessman was found to be in possession of 23,800 packs of cigarettes and 2,800 packs of hookah tobacco that were not properly labeled. This shipment is the largest batch of smuggled goods seized by customs officials in the area in 2024.

Some of the products did not have a label indicating that consumption tax had been paid, or the labels used showed signs of being fake. The total value of the batch of goods exceeded 3 million rubles (35,151 US dollars).


Currently, law enforcement officials are deciding whether to bring criminal charges against the businessman.
